    Colorado Buffaloes superstar Travis Hunter is expected to be one of the top five players selected in next Thursday’s 2025 NFL Draft. Hunter could very well be selected by the Cleveland Browns or the New York Giants.

    He will have a chance to shine at cornerback and wide receiver at the next level. It will be interesting to see which position he will play at more in the NFL. Hunter was the Heisman Trophy winner during the 2024 college football season over Boise State Broncos running back Ashton Jeanty.

    Colorado Buffaloes Star Travis Hunter Makes Bold Statement Ahead Of 2025 NFL Draft

    Buffaloes star player Hunter was interviewed by CBS Sports writer Garrett Podell. Podell asked him,

    “If you had to choose only one position in the NFL or never playing football again would what you choose?”

    Hunter responded,

    “It’s never playing football again.”

    The star Buffaloes player also mentioned as to why he made that statement about rather not playing football again compared to only playing on one side of the ball in the NFL. Hunter said, 

    “Because I’ve been doing that my whole life and I love being on the football field and I feel like I can dominate on each side.”

    Hunter is 6’1″ and weighs 185 lbs. During the 2024 college football season with Colorado, he caught 96 passes for 1,258 yards receiving and 15 touchdowns, along with averaging 13.1 yards per reception. Hunter also had his longest reception of 58 yards.

    On the defensive side of the football with Colorado in 2024, he recorded 35 total tackles, 11 pass deflections, one forced fumble, and four interceptions. It remains to be seen how NFL teams will use him in the future when they draft him. Hunter is one of the most talented players in the 2025 NFL Draft also.
